Watch county notification for watch 128
National Weather Service Fort Worth TX
512 PM CDT Thu Apr 18 2024
The NWS Storm Prediction Center has issued a
* Severe Thunderstorm Watch for portions of Central and North Texas*
Effective this Thursday afternoon and evening from 510 PM until 1100 PM CDT.* Primary threats include... Scattered large hail likely with isolated very large hail events to 2 inches in diameter possible Scattered damaging wind gusts to 65 mph possible
SUMMARY...At least isolated strong to severe storms are expected to further develop across central Texas, and possibly into additional parts of North/Northeast Texas this evening.
